About N-(3,4-dichlorophenyl)-1-(6-methyl-1,3-benzothiazol-2-yl)azetidine-3-carboxamide
N-(3,4-dichlorophenyl)-1-(6-methyl-1,3-benzothiazol-2-yl)azetidine-3-carboxamide (PubChem CID 121128234) has the molecular formula C18H15Cl2N3OS
and a molecular weight of 392.31 g/mol. Its IUPAC name is N-(3,4-dichlorophenyl)-1-(6-methyl-1,3-benzothiazol-2-yl)azetidine-3-carboxamide.

What is the SMILES notation for N-(3,4-dichlorophenyl)-1-(6-methyl-1,3-benzothiazol-2-yl)azetidine-3-carboxamide?
The canonical SMILES for N-(3,4-dichlorophenyl)-1-(6-methyl-1,3-benzothiazol-2-yl)azetidine-3-carboxamide is Cc1ccc2nc(N3CC(C(=O)Nc4ccc(Cl)c(Cl)c4)C3)sc2c1.
What is the InChIKey of N-(3,4-dichlorophenyl)-1-(6-methyl-1,3-benzothiazol-2-yl)azetidine-3-carboxamide?
The InChIKey is YRPGNAPEUMUGEN-UHFFFAOYSA-N. The full InChI is InChI=1S/C18H15Cl2N3OS/c1-10-2-5-15-16(6-10)25-18(22-15)23-8-11(9-23)17(24)21-12-3-4-13(19)14(20)7-12/h2-7,11H,8-9H2,1H3,(H,21,24).
What are the key properties of N-(3,4-dichlorophenyl)-1-(6-methyl-1,3-benzothiazol-2-yl)azetidine-3-carboxamide?
N-(3,4-dichlorophenyl)-1-(6-methyl-1,3-benzothiazol-2-yl)azetidine-3-carboxamide has a molecular weight of 392.31 g/mol, XLogP of 4.99, 3 rotatable bonds, 1 hydrogen bond donors, and 4 hydrogen bond acceptors.
